Christian Bible Lesson 107: Faith And Works In Your Entire Life
The way we live demonstrates what we believe and illustrates if the faith we say we have is real. Faith without works is not real because true faith affects life. It is important that we demonstrate the fruit of good works.
True faith will lead to a transformed life, faith is defined by our actions. What we do reflects what we believe and whether our faith is true. True faith changes life, supported by works.
Christian Bible Lesson 106: Testing of Faith versus Temptation
The Bible makes a major distinction between “Testing of Faith” and “Temptation”. There are examples in the Bible of “Testing of Faith”. These are examples of people facing challenges in life that are difficult to face such as financial challenges, loss of a child, challenges with work, etc. Clearly, God does not give us challenges that are greater than we can handle. It is important that we are prepared to face life challenges and work through them with the faith that we will overcome them.
